Decoding Emotions: AI's Journey into the Realm of Feeling
The domain of human emotions has long been a mystery for researchers. Traditionally, understanding feelings relied on subjective interpretations and complex psychological analysis. But now, artificial intelligence (AI) is embarking on a intriguing journey to interpret these abstract states.
Novel AI algorithms are being to analyze vast archives of human interactions, hunting for patterns that correspond with specific emotions. Through neural networks, these AI systems are grasping to distinguish subtle indicators in facial expressions, voice tone, and even textual communication.
- Concurrently, this transformative technology has the potential to alter the way we perceive emotions, presenting valuable insights in fields such as well-being, education, and even client relations.
The Human Touch: Where AI Falls Short in Emotional Intelligence
While artificial intelligence continues to a staggering pace, there remains a crucial area where it falls short: emotional intelligence. AI algorithms struggle to truly grasp the complexities of human emotions. They are devoid of the capacity for empathy, compassion, and intuition that are vital for navigating social interactions. AI may be able to process facial expressions and tone in voice, but it fails to authentically feel what lies beneath the surface. This fundamental difference highlights the enduring value of human connection and the irreplaceable part that emotions have in shaping our experiences.
